Freezing Whole Eggs In Shell: A Complete Guide And Tips

can you freeze whole eggs in shell

Freezing whole eggs in their shells is a common question among those looking to preserve eggs for extended periods, but it’s important to note that this method is not recommended. When eggs are frozen in their shells, the liquid inside expands, causing the shell to crack and potentially allowing bacteria to enter, which can lead to spoilage or contamination. Additionally, the texture and quality of the egg can be significantly compromised once thawed. However, there are safe alternatives for freezing eggs, such as removing them from their shells and freezing them in airtight containers or ice cube trays, which can be a practical solution for those looking to store eggs for future use.

Safety Concerns: Risks of freezing eggs in shells, including potential bacterial growth and shell cracks

Freezing whole eggs in their shells is a practice that raises significant safety concerns, primarily due to the risk of bacterial growth and shell cracks. The porous nature of eggshells allows moisture and air to pass through, creating an environment conducive to bacterial contamination. When eggs are frozen, the water inside expands, exerting pressure on the shell. This expansion can cause microscopic cracks, which not only compromise the egg’s structural integrity but also provide entry points for bacteria like *Salmonella*. Once thawed, these bacteria can multiply rapidly, posing a serious health risk if the eggs are consumed.

Consider the mechanics of freezing: as the liquid inside the egg turns to ice, it expands by about 9%, creating enough force to fracture even the strongest shells. These cracks, often invisible to the naked eye, can allow bacteria from the shell’s surface to infiltrate the egg’s interior. Additionally, freezing does not kill bacteria; it merely slows their growth. If the eggs were contaminated before freezing, the bacteria remain viable and can thrive once the eggs are thawed and returned to room temperature. This is particularly concerning given that raw or undercooked eggs are a common source of foodborne illness.

From a practical standpoint, the USDA explicitly advises against freezing eggs in their shells due to these risks. Instead, they recommend freezing eggs by cracking them first and removing the contents from the shell. For those intent on preserving whole eggs, pasteurized shell eggs are a safer alternative, as the pasteurization process reduces the risk of bacterial contamination. However, even pasteurized eggs should not be frozen in their shells, as the physical risks of cracking remain unchanged.

To minimize risk, if you must freeze eggs, follow these steps: crack the eggs into a clean container, beat them slightly to blend yolks and whites, and store them in airtight containers or ice cube trays. Label with the date and use within four months for best quality. Avoid refreezing thawed eggs, as temperature fluctuations can further encourage bacterial growth. While freezing whole eggs in shells may seem convenient, the potential hazards far outweigh the benefits, making alternative methods the safer choice.

Quality Impact: Effects of freezing on egg texture, taste, and nutritional value

Freezing whole eggs in their shells is generally discouraged due to the risk of explosion as the liquid inside expands. However, if you’re considering freezing eggs without their shells, the quality impact on texture, taste, and nutritional value becomes a critical concern. When eggs are frozen, the water content forms ice crystals, which can disrupt the protein structure. This process often results in a rubbery texture once thawed, particularly in the egg whites, which can become tough and unappetizing. For best results, beat the eggs before freezing to minimize separation and texture changes.

Taste is another factor affected by freezing. While the flavor of frozen eggs remains largely intact, subtle changes can occur due to oxidation and the breakdown of fat molecules. To mitigate this, add a pinch of salt or sugar (1/8 teaspoon per cup of beaten eggs) before freezing, which can help preserve flavor. However, frozen eggs are best used in baked goods or scrambled dishes rather than recipes where their taste and texture are prominent, such as fried eggs or custards.

Nutritional value is a bright spot in the freezing process. Studies show that freezing eggs retains most of their essential nutrients, including protein, vitamins A, D, and E, and minerals like selenium. However, water-soluble vitamins like B12 and riboflavin may degrade slightly over time, especially if stored improperly. To maximize nutrient retention, freeze eggs in airtight containers or heavy-duty freezer bags, and use them within 6–9 months for optimal quality.

For practical application, consider freezing eggs in ice cube trays for easy portioning. Each cube typically holds about 2 tablespoons of beaten egg, equivalent to one large egg. Label containers with the date and contents, and thaw frozen eggs overnight in the refrigerator before use. While freezing alters texture and taste to some extent, it remains a viable method for preserving eggs, especially when fresh alternatives are unavailable.

Alternatives: Safer methods like freezing eggs without shells or using commercial preservatives

Freezing whole eggs in their shells is widely discouraged due to safety and quality concerns, but alternatives exist that preserve eggs effectively without compromising safety. One proven method is freezing eggs without their shells. To do this, crack the eggs into a bowl, whisk them lightly to blend yolks and whites, and pour the mixture into ice cube trays or freezer-safe containers. Each cube typically holds about 2 tablespoons, equivalent to one large egg. Label the container with the date and quantity, and store in the freezer for up to a year. This method is ideal for baking, scrambling, or cooking, though thawed eggs may have a slightly altered texture, making them less suitable for dishes like fried eggs or poaching.
